Photocurrent Spectroscopy of Perovskite Layers and Solar Cells: A Sensitive Probe of Material Degradation

Jakub Holovský; Stefaan De Wolf; Jérémie Werner; Zdeněk Remeš; Martin Müller; Neda Neykova; Martin Ledinský; Ladislava Černá; Pavel Hrzina; Philipp Löper; Bjoern Niesen; Christophe Ballif

Optical absorptance spectroscopy of polycrystalline CH3NH3PbI3 films usually indicates the presence of a PbI2 phase, either as a preparation residue or due to film degradation, but gives no insight on how this may affect electrical properties. Here, we apply photocurrent spectroscopy to both perovskite solar cells and coplanar-contacted layers at various stages of degradation. In both cases, we find that the presence of a PbI2 phase restricts charge-carrier transport, suggesting that PbI2 encapsulates CH3NH3PbI3 grains. We also find that PbI2 injects holes into the CH3NH3PbI3 grains, increasing the apparent photosensitivity of PbI2. This phenomenon, known as modulation doping, is absent in the photocurrent spectra of solar cells, where holes and electrons have to be collected in pairs. This interpretation provides insights into the photogeneration and carrier transport in dual-phase perovskites.

Using measurement of AC parameters for CIGS PV modules degradation studying

Ladislava Černá; P. Černek; Pavel Hrzina; Vitezslav Benda

There are many diagnostic methods for PV modules parameters determination used. Most of them are based on measurement of static parameters, but therefore exist also measurement methods for AC parameters such a capacitance or impedance determination. In the paper is described Time Domain Reflectometry method which can be used for differentiation of PV modules with same static plate values. Different AC parameters can cause dissimilar behavior in alternating fields leading to premature degradation.

Parameters of the magnetic core and parasitic structure in RF SMPS circuit

Pavel Hrzina; J. Zacek

This article describes the system for measurement of parasitic parameters of designed SMPS (switched mode power supply) structures operating at frequencies of hundreds of kHz. The method uses a comparison between simulation results and practical measurement. For simulation the most popular circuit simulators as PSPICE, PSIM, SIMULINK can be applied
